Job Overview
We are looking to recruit a band 5 staff nurse to cover maternity leave.
We are looking for motivated and caring Staff nurse to join a dedicated Paediatric Team in our Paediatric Outpatient department. You will be required to work over our other sites in the Wigan borough therefore a car user/driver is essential to this post.
We are looking for enthusiasm, drive, and passion where the delivery of outstanding levels of care can be nurtured.
- You will have excellent communication skills
- The flexibility and adaptability to meet the needs of Children and their Families whilst maintaining a safe environment
- Motivated and committed to delivering high quality care to patients in a busy and fast paced area
You will work as part of a team to provide high quality, safe and child centred care.
The successful candidate will be efficient, reliable, and able to work using their own initiative whilst being part of a team. You will be dedicated to assisting in the delivery and the development of an excellent service.

We are looking to recruit to a 20 hour post, with a working pattern across 5 days (internal rotation).
NHS Employees should ideally secure their manager’s agreement for a secondment arrangement ideally prior to applying, as this will be a condition of any offer made. This vacancy is advertised on a fixed term basis as It has been established to cover maternity leave and will end in 12 months or when the substantive postholder returns. Whilst this post is advertised on an acting / secondment basis there is the potential that this post may become permanent in the future.
Main Duties
You will be responsible for providing a range of personal care for patients and a range of clinical duties.
Band 5 staff nurses work independently performing a number of clinical duties/tasks following training and meeting competency within role as per policy and procedure. You will be responsible for providing a range of personal care for patients and a range of clinical duties under the guidance of a registered healthcare professional.
